Output e0676803264ef9952e7217324eefdcec728e4b87d9a0d2027cab7c006015ab8b:1

value
12520000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 218de34938ee73efb2f52284f4613aab18533c17 OP_EQUAL
address
9uVgwG2JKw2wkvrsi5n5oHFdEh45eJecsU
transaction
e0676803264ef9952e7217324eefdcec728e4b87d9a0d2027cab7c006015ab8b